Colvic Craft 31
Masthead Ketch · Long Keel · First built 1972
A 1972 Colvic-built cruiser featuring a high comfort ratio and shallow 1.22-metre draft for versatile coastal work
Designed by John Bennet & Assoc, built by Covic Craft.

Character
Where this design lands on the numbers a shopper trusts — read straight from her own ratios.
Her heavy displacement on a moderate beam gives 39 — a sea-kindly motion in a seaway.
At 1.60 she sits well under the 2.0 line — a solidly ocean-capable hull for her size.
320 — heavy for her waterline, built to carry stores and ride steadily.
7.5 — modest power for her weight; easygoing rather than lively, and happier with a breeze.
Built heavy and sea-kindly — a boat made to cross oceans and forgive a rough night.
